Baby’s breath Snowflake
Gypsophila paniculata / Baby's Breath
Gypsophila paniculata ‘Snowflake’ is a hardy perennial baby’s breath grown for clouds of pure white, double to semi-double flowers on branching stems. It is useful for fresh cuts, dried bunches, bouquet recipes and wedding work, especially for small growers who want a seed-accessible perennial gypsophila rather than relying only on imported commodity stems. It needs full sun, excellent drainage, neutral to alkaline calcium-rich soil and careful postharvest handling. The main caution is uniformity: seed strains may not produce 100% fully double plants, so growers should trial, grade and select the best plants before scaling up.

Baby’s breath Bristol Fairy
White / Filler
Gypsophila paniculata ‘Bristol Fairy’ is the classic double white perennial baby’s breath: a soft, airy, cloudlike filler used in bouquets, wedding work and dried arrangements. It prefers full sun, high light, alkaline calcium-rich soil and excellent drainage. It is best planned as a dedicated perennial filler crop rather than a quick annual succession. Stems should be harvested according to market distance: more open for local use and drying, less open for shipping or storage. The crop is highly sensitive to poor postharvest handling, ethylene and Botrytis, so clean buckets, rapid hydration and cool storage are essential.

Baby’s breath Covent Garden
White / Filler
Gypsophila elegans 'Covent Garden' is a fast, airy, white annual baby's breath grown from seed for bouquets, weddings, subscriptions, and dried filler. It is not the heavy perennial florist baby's breath used in imported bunches; it is lighter, quicker, more seasonal, and better suited to local garden-style design. The crop is valuable because it can make mixed bouquets feel fuller and more professional without taking as long as perennials or shrubs. It prefers full sun, well-drained neutral to alkaline soil, moderate moisture while establishing, and good airflow at flowering. For best results, sow successions rather than relying on one planting, harvest when around half to two-thirds of the flowers are open, and cool or condition immediately.

Baby’s breath Double Time
White / Filler
Gypsophila paniculata is the classic perennial baby's breath used by florists as a soft white filler. It is not a casual filler crop when grown commercially: the best stems come from well-drained, high-light plantings with support netting, clean water management, good airflow, and careful harvest timing. It can be excellent for weddings, dried work, florist bunches, and bouquet volume, but it becomes risky in wet, humid conditions where Botrytis and flower browning can destroy market quality.

Baby’s breath Festival Star
White / Filler
Festival Star® is a compact, long-blooming, sterile hardy baby’s breath that produces clouds of small white flowers on tidy gray-green plants. It is best used as a local bouquet filler, wedding texture, dried flower, and perennial border crop. Its main planning warning is stem length: it is shorter than classic commercial gypsophila, so it should be sold by bunch, bouquet recipe, or dried bundle rather than as a direct replacement for tall imported stems.

Baby’s breath Million Stars
White / Filler
Million Stars is a refined commercial baby’s breath grown for clouds of tiny clean white florets on branching stems. It is best used as a high-demand florist filler rather than a casual garden perennial. For flower farms, its value is strongest where there is wedding, florist, subscription, or wholesale demand for reliable white texture. It needs excellent drainage, full sun, clean planting stock, long days for strong flowering, and careful postharvest sanitation. It can be profitable, but it is not a forgiving beginner crop in wet or humid conditions.

Baby’s breath New Love
White / Filler
Gypsophila paniculata ‘New Love’ is a white florist baby’s breath selected for clean, airy filler stems used in bouquets, weddings, installations and dried work. It should be grown like perennial baby’s breath: full sun, excellent drainage, neutral-to-alkaline calcium-rich soil, generous airflow and careful postharvest hygiene. It is a familiar, sellable crop, but local growers must compete with imported gyp, so quality, freshness, bunch consistency and wedding timing matter.

Baby’s breath Perfecta
White / Filler
Gypsophila paniculata ‘Perfecta’ is a vigorous, large-flowered, double white perennial baby’s breath used as a florist and wedding filler. It prefers full sun, high light, neutral to alkaline calcium-rich soil and excellent drainage. Compared with older ‘Bristol Fairy’, it is generally treated as larger and more vigorous, with broader white sprays, but modern commercial growers may choose newer cultivars for easier handling or shorter crop times. Stems should be harvested according to market distance: more open for local use and drying, less open for shipping or storage. The crop is highly sensitive to poor postharvest handling, ethylene and Botrytis, so clean buckets, rapid hydration and cool storage are essential.
